Trust is the foundation of any healthy relationship. But what happens when you start to suspect that your partner is hiding stories from you? It can be an unsettling feeling, questioning why they feel the need to keep secrets. Understanding the reasons why he may be hiding stories from you can help shed light on the situation and determine the appropriate steps to take.
1. Fear of judgment: One of the most common reasons why someone may hide stories from their partner is the fear of being judged. They may worry that sharing certain experiences or details may lead to disappointment, anger, or even a loss of love. This fear can stem from insecurities or past negative experiences in other relationships.
2. Protecting your feelings: In some cases, he may be hiding stories from you to protect your emotions. He may believe that the truth could hurt you, and out of love and concern, he chooses to keep certain things to himself. While his intentions may be noble, it is essential to have open and honest communication to build trust and understanding.
3. Avoiding conflict: Another reason for hiding stories could be a desire to avoid conflict or confrontation. He might be unsure of how you will react to certain information, especially if the topic is sensitive. It’s crucial to create a safe space where both partners feel comfortable expressing themselves without the fear of judgment or discord.
4. Emotional baggage: Past experiences can shape a person’s behavior. If he has been hurt or betrayed in the past, it can contribute to his reluctance to share personal stories with you. He may be guarding his heart to prevent further pain or disappointment. Patience and understanding can help overcome this barrier and create a stronger bond built on trust.
5. Fear of losing independence: Hiding stories may be a way for him to maintain a sense of independence and autonomy. He may believe that revealing every detail would invade his personal space and hinder his freedom. It’s essential to strike a balance between individuality and shared experiences in a relationship to ensure both partners’ satisfaction.
6. Privacy concerns: Everyone has a right to privacy, even in a committed relationship. He might be hiding stories simply because he values his privacy and doesn’t feel obligated to disclose every aspect of his life. Building trust means respecting each other’s need for personal boundaries while also maintaining open lines of communication.
7. Lack of trust: It’s crucial to consider that he might be hiding stories from you due to a lack of trust in the relationship. If there has been a breach of trust in the past, such as infidelity or dishonesty, he may be hesitant to share information for fear of recurring issues. Rebuilding trust takes time, patience, and a commitment to open and honest communication.
8. Personal insecurities: Your partner’s own insecurities could be driving him to hide stories. He may worry about how you perceive him and fear that revealing certain aspects of his life or past will result in rejection. Creating a safe and non-judgmental environment can help alleviate these insecurities and encourage him to open up.
Communication is key in any relationship. If you suspect that your partner is hiding stories from you, it’s crucial to approach the topic with empathy and understanding. Express your concerns, create a safe space for open dialogue, and work together to build trust and strengthen your bond. Remember, it takes effort and commitment from both partners to establish a foundation built on honesty and trust.
